 
  Consumer experience
Share order location and progress with consumers to help them monitor the status of their ride, food delivery, package delivery or service visit with the Consumer SDK.
- 
  
  Consumer SDK for on-demand tripsEnhance your consumer mobile app with near real-time location updates and road-snapped positions of on-demand trips. 
- 
  
  Consumer SDK for scheduled tasksEnhance your consumer web app to let your shipment consumers follow the driver's shared journey and the status of their package or scheduled service. 
 
  How to integrate the Consumer SDK
            These steps outline the high-level workflow for integrating the Consumer SDK into your consumer app so that it works with Fleet Engine.
          
        
        
          - 
  
  Understand the consumer experience for on-demand tripsModel and share on-demand trip data and allow consumers to follow trips by accessing trip data in Fleet Engine.
- 
  
  Understand the consumer experience for scheduled tasksModel and share scheduled task data and allow consumers to follow task progress by accessing trip data in Fleet Engine.
- 
  
  Set up the Consumer SDKThe Consumer SDK gets real-time location updates from Fleet Engine, enabling you to share trip and task progress in your mobility solution.
- 
  
  Manage journeys through Fleet EngineFleet Engine handles the interaction between the Driver SDK and your own backend service. Your backend service can communicate with the Fleet Engine by making either REST or gRPC calls.
Consumer SDK Reference
On-demand trips Reference
            Create the consumer experience for on-demand trips.
          
        
        
        
          
        
      Shipment tracking Reference
            Create the consumer experience for scheduled shipment tasks.